- Growing Emphasis on Sustainability
One of the prominent market trends in the brick block making machine industry is the growing emphasis on sustainability. With increasing awareness of environmental issues, construction companies and manufacturers are seeking eco-friendly solutions. As a result, brick block making machines that utilize alternative materials, such as fly ash, recycled aggregates, or even construction waste, are gaining popularity. These sustainable practices not only reduce the environmental impact but also enhance the market reputation of manufacturers as responsible and forward-thinking entities.
Additionally, the integration of energy-efficient kiln technologies, water recycling systems, and solar-powered machines is becoming more prevalent, further contributing to sustainability in the brick block manufacturing process.
- Automation and Smart Manufacturing
Automation and smart manufacturing have become major trends in various industries, and the brick block making sector is no exception. Automation enables higher productivity, improved precision, and reduced labor costs. Modern brick block making machines are equipped with advanced computerized systems and robotic technology, enabling seamless operations and minimizing human intervention.
Furthermore, the integration of Internet of Things (IoT) technology allows manufacturers to monitor machine performance remotely, conduct predictive maintenance, and optimize production processes. Smart manufacturing not only enhances efficiency but also provides valuable data insights that can lead to continuous process improvements.
- Interlocking Brick Technology
Interlocking brick technology has gained significant traction in the brick block making machine market. Interlocking bricks are designed with unique grooves and ridges that allow them to fit together without the need for mortar or adhesives. This technology reduces construction time, labor costs, and material wastage while improving the structural integrity and earthquake resistance of buildings.
The use of interlocking bricks is particularly popular in low-cost housing projects, as it provides a cost-effective and efficient construction solution. As urbanization continues to accelerate globally, the demand for interlocking brick-making machines is expected to grow.
